    The Lordship and The Body

    Every church claims that Jesus is in charge. The question worth asking — the one most churches quietly avoid — is whether He actually is. Not in the statement of faith. Not in the language used from the stage. But in the real, daily decisions that shape what a church preaches, how it spends its resources, what it prioritizes, and what it is willing to let go of when faithfulness costs something. In Week 2 of Built, Pastor Kevin Cox takes the congregation into two of Paul's most theologically dense letters — Ephesians and Colossians — to recover what the headship of Christ actually means and what it looks like when a church lives under it. Drawing from Ephesians 1:22–23 and Colossians 1:18, this message confronts the quiet inversion at the heart of so much contemporary Christianity: a church that honors Christ in its confession while functionally running on a different engine entirely. The result of that inversion is not hard to identify — congregations that are numerically impressive and spiritually thin, members who know the songs by heart and cannot articulate the gospel, communities built for consumers rather than formed as disciples. This message calls the church back to the standard Paul sets without apology: that in everything, Christ must be preeminent. Not first among several priorities. First in a category of His own.

    Biblical Forgiveness: A Decision of The Will

    Forgiveness is not a feeling. It is a decision. It is an act of the will, grounded in theology, commanded by God, and made possible only by the grace that has already been extended to you. You do not wait to feel like forgiving. You choose to forgive because God, in Christ, chose to forgive you.

    Rooted, Anchored, and Established

    In a world saturated with spiritual confusion, competing philosophies, and counterfeit versions of Christianity, believers are continually pressured to move beyond Christ in search of something “more.” Yet Scripture is clear: everything necessary for spiritual life, growth, and stability is found in Him alone.In Colossians 2:6–7, the Apostle Paul delivers a concise but profound summary of the Christian life. Writing to a church threatened by false teaching, Paul calls believers back to the foundation of their faith—not to new ideas, mystical experiences, or human wisdom, but to Christ Himself. As we have received Christ Jesus the Lord, so we are commanded to walk in Him—rooted, built up, and firmly established in the faith.This teaching unfolds Paul’s inspired progression of spiritual maturity, showing how genuine faith is grounded in Christ, nourished through continual dependence upon Him, strengthened through sound doctrine, and ultimately marked by a life overflowing with thanksgiving. Far from being a superficial or emotional faith, this passage calls believers to a deep, unwavering, Christ-centered walk that withstands deception and produces lasting spiritual fruit.This message is both a call to examine the foundation of our faith and an encouragement to remain anchored in the all-sufficient Christ.
